News Stands in Meeker, OK
5. Choctaw Times
2424 Main St, Choctaw, OK 73020
6. Oklahoma Living
2325 E I 44 Service Rd, Oklahoma City, OK 73111
CLOSED NOW:Closed
Showing 1-6 of 6
2424 Main St, Choctaw, OK 73020
2325 E I 44 Service Rd, Oklahoma City, OK 73111
Showing 1-6 of 6